1. Data Analysis and Interpretation
At the heart of education technology research lies the ability to efficiently analyze and interpret complex datasets. Analysts must extract meaningful insights from quantitative and qualitative data, using statistical techniques and software like SPSS, R, Python, or Excel. This skill enables accurate evaluation of the effectiveness of educational programs and technology tools.
- Knowledge of statistical methods (e.g., regression, ANOVA, factor analysis)
- Experience with data visualization tools (Tableau, Power BI)
- Ability to synthesize and report findings in accessible formats
2. Research Design and Methodology
Educational research demands a strong foundation in research design. Analysts must know how to frame research questions, select appropriate methodologies (such as surveys, focus groups, experiments, or case studies), and ensure reliable results. Robust research design skills help guarantee validity and credibility of findings.
- Understanding qualitative and quantitative research techniques
- Experience designing instruments like questionnaires and interview guides
- Ability to apply ethical research standards
3. Technology Literacy
In education technology environments, analysts need to be comfortable with a wide range of digital tools, learning management systems (LMS), and analytics platforms. Staying current with educational technologies (such as AI-enabled tutoring, adaptive learning tools, and cloud-based resources) positions you as a forward-thinking expert.
- Familiarity with LMS platforms (Canvas, Blackboard, Moodle)
- Understanding educational apps and software
- Awareness of emerging EdTech trends and tools

8. Knowledge of Educational Policies and Standards
Educational analysts must be familiar with academic policies, regulatory standards, and data privacy guidelines affecting education technology. This ensures compliance and shapes the relevance of research studies within institutional and governmental frameworks.
- Understanding FERPA, GDPR, and institutional privacy protocols
- Awareness of national and international education standards
- Knowledge of ethical considerations in educational research
